The “Original Nineteens” shoes were designed and sold by the I. Miller Shoe Company. The I. Miller shoe store, which was fondly called I. Miller’s, was located at 13th and F Streets, NW in Washington, DC. The Nineteens were at the height of popularity during the late 50’s and 60’s.The original shoes sold for $16 and as the popularity of the shoes increased, so did the price. At times, as a result of the changing price of the shoes, they were called 16’s, 19’s, 20’s, and 21’s, but 19’s seemed to be the name that stuck with the shoe. When I. Miller closed for business the cost of the shoes was $21.00.
The Nineteens were one of the most popular shoes worn by young African American females in the Washington Metropolitan area, Baltimore, and New Jersey. As we reflect on this shoe today, there are many stories to be told to a new generation of consumers about our beloved shoes.
